Lot Description
ROLEX - a bi-metal quartz gentleman's Oysterquartz Datejust bracelet watch circa 1980, the champagne sunburst effect dial with hourly applied batons, bordered by a minute track, date aperture positioned to three o'clock, tonneau shaped case, fitted to a bi-metal link bracelet with folding clasp, reference number 17013, serial number 6563025, movement calibre 5035. Case width 36mm.

Condition Report
Rolex bracelet watch, quartz movement is not currently functioning and requires attention, dial appears to be in good condition, hands have light marks, glass has some minor chips to the edge that are visible around 6 o'clock ,case has marks and scratches as a result of general wear, left hand side of the case has visible scratches and some tiny dints, front of the case shows some tiny dints, bracelet has noticeable scratching and scuffing which is partially evident close to the clasp, bracelet appears to be stretched, clasp has marks and noticeable scratches and scuffing. Bracelet measures 18cm including case.
Due to the opening of the case back we recommend that this watch be resealed by an authorised technician before use near water.
Please note that this lot does not come with box or papers.

Importation of Watches into the US
Bidders should be aware that the import of Rolex watches to the US is restricted. Watches (not limited to Rolex) may not be shipped to the USA and import must be undertaken personally. Generally only one watch may be imported in this manner at any one time.
It is the responsibility of the prospective buyer to identify and comply with any restrictions. Please contact our department specialist for further information.
